What are the typical costs for indoor vs. outdoor boat storage in Seneca, IL, and what factors influence pricing?
In Seneca, IL, outdoor uncovered storage typically ranges from $40 to $80 per month for standard-sized boats, while covered storage (canopies or lean-tos) can cost $80 to $150 monthly. Fully enclosed, climate-controlled indoor storage is less common but may range from $150 to $300+ per month. Pricing is influenced by the size of your boat (especially length), the level of protection, proximity to the Illinois River or local marinas, and seasonal demand. Storage facilities near the Seneca Regional Port often command a premium. Winter storage contracts (October-April) may offer discounted rates compared to month-to-month plans.
How does Seneca's climate, particularly winter, affect my boat storage choices and necessary preparations?
Seneca experiences cold winters with average lows in the teens and potential for significant snow and ice. This climate makes proper winterization non-negotiable. For outdoor storage, a high-quality, fitted cover is essential to protect against snow load and moisture. Many owners in the area opt for indoor or covered storage to shield their boats from the elements. Facilities often require proof of winterization (engine fogging, fluid draining, etc.) before accepting boats for long-term winter storage. Given the proximity to the Illinois River, humidity control in indoor units is also a consideration to prevent mold and mildew during the off-season.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in the Seneca area?
Given Seneca's location near major transportation routes like I-80 and the Illinois River, security is a key concern. Reputable facilities in the area should offer gated access with personalized entry codes, perimeter fencing, and well-lit premises. Look for 24/7 video surveillance, especially for outdoor lots. Some facilities may have on-site managers or regular patrols. For high-value boats, inquire about individually alarmed units for indoor storage. It's also wise to choose a facility that requires proof of ownership and insurance, which deters illegitimate activity.
How does the boating season on the Illinois River impact storage availability and rental terms in Seneca?
The active boating season on the Illinois River typically runs from late April through early October. This creates a high demand for storage, both at the start of the season (for easy water access) and at the end (for winter storage). In Seneca, availability at marinas and storage facilities near the river can tighten significantly in April-May and September-October. Many facilities offer seasonal contracts, with the most common being a 6-month 'in-season' contract or a 6-month 'winter' contract. To secure the best spot and rate, especially for covered or indoor storage, it's advisable to book your winter storage by late summer and your summer storage by early spring.
